5. Heights Co. has asked you to consult on the effects of the following on the EPS calculation. a. Heights issued 15,000 stock options exchangeable into common shares on a one for one basis. The exercise price of the option is $ 10. and the average market price is $ 20 for the year. Calculate the number of shares to account for the stock options. b. Heights has $ 1,500,000 of convertible bonds outstanding. They pay interest of $ 38,000 and upon conversion would add 45,000 shares to the weighted average shares outstanding. Assume that net income is $ 230,000,weighted average shares outstanding was 100,000 and preferred dividends are $ 25,000, what would be the reported diluted earnings per share? C. Lowes, a subsidiary of Heights, has cumulative convertible preferred shares that pay a dividend of $ 12,000 and convert into 15,000 common shares. Assume net income of $ 125,000, common shares outstanding of 60,000 what is the diluted earnings per share?
